Please apply at: Field Service EngineerReports to: Analytical and Combustion Systems | Want to apply Read all the information about this position below, then hit the apply button.About the job: Analytical & Combustion Systems [ACS], a Subsidiary of Preferred Holdings Company, is a manufacturer's representative located in Bethel, CT with a variety of lines that serve industrial, commercial, and large-scale residential steam and hot water plants. ACS is looking for the right candidate for a field service engineer position located in and covering the greater New York City area. The ideal candidate will have formal college or trade school education and have experience in the industrial and commercial boiler market. Daily travel throughout the territory is required, but overnight trips will be very rare.Nature and Scope of Position:This position is primarily technical in nature and requires an in-depth knowledge of the design and operation of control systems, data acquisition systems, PLC's, boilers, burner management systems, combustion and draft control systems, and fuel oil supply and gauging systems. Due to the high visibility this position has to customers, the holder of this position is required to maintain a high level of diplomacy with the customer at all times and act in the best interest of Analytical & Combustion Systems. The holder of this position is expected to make every effort to remain current with the ever-developing technology concerning this trade and be familiar with the general overview of represented manufacturers' equipment and the services it supplies to the industry. Provide technical assistance as needed to customers or other employees of ACS. This includes providing troubleshooting assistance over the phone, supplying documentation and follow-up to ensure timely and effective customer support. Provide equipment operations and maintenance training to customers.2. Daily complete a Service Report in the manner outlined in the ACS Services Policy Handbook.3. Access company server and Apps to upload and download documentation, service reports, product manuals, and electrical/mechanical prints.4. Install, start-up, and service on an as needed basis all equipment sold by ACS in addition to any customers' equipment ACS Services wishes to take the responsibility for. All work performed must be in compliance with ACS standards and policies and comply with all the applicable codes as stated by the authority having jurisdiction in the area where the work is being performed.5. Promote the sales of maintenance contracts, spare parts and/or new equipment.6. Configure and program as instructed by engineering any controls or systems being commissioned or serviced by ACS Services. Supply home office Engineering all updated configurations, programs, marked up prints, etc.7. Provide tangible feedback via a "Blind Field Service Reports" and QC reports to engineering on the operation and performance of new equipment, control panels and design concepts.8. Perform electrical troubleshooting on boiler and fuel oil control systems and field devices.9.
